Yes, a low-carb diet can be an effective nutritional strategy for managing menopause. Studies have shown that low-carb diets can help women control weight gain, reduce hot flashes, and improve insulin sensitivity during this period.

Some potential risks of following a low-carb diet during menopause include nutrient deficiencies, constipation, and an increased risk of osteoporosis if not balanced properly with other dietary factors. It is recommended to consult with a healthcare professional before making any significant dietary changes.
